GNU/Linux >> Znalost Linux >  >> Linux

Jak zkontrolovat verzi jádra v Linuxu

Jádro je základní součástí operačního systému. Spravuje systémové prostředky a je mostem mezi hardwarem a softwarem vašeho počítače.

Existuje několik důvodů, proč byste mohli potřebovat znát verzi jádra, které běží na vašem operačním systému GNU/Linux. Možná ladíte problém související s hardwarem nebo jste se dozvěděli o nové bezpečnostní chybě ovlivňující starší verze jádra a chcete zjistit, zda je vaše jádro zranitelné či nikoli. Ať už je důvod jakýkoli, je docela snadné určit verzi linuxového jádra z příkazového řádku.

V tomto tutoriálu vám ukážeme několik různých způsobů, jak zjistit, jaká verze linuxového jádra běží na vašem systému.

Použití uname Příkaz #

uname zobrazí několik systémových informací včetně architektury linuxového jádra, verze názvu a vydání.

Chcete-li zjistit, jaká verze linuxového jádra běží na vašem systému, zadejte následující příkaz:

uname -srm
Linux 4.15.0-54-generic x86_64

Výše uvedený výstup ukazuje, že linuxové jádro je 64bitové a jeho verze je 4.15.0-54 , kde:

  • 4 - Verze jádra.
  • 15 - Hlavní revize.
  • 0 - Malá revize.
  • 54 - Číslo opravy.
  • generic - Informace specifické pro distribuci.

Pomocí hostnamectl příkaz #

hostnamectl obslužný program je součástí systemd a používá se k dotazování a změně názvu hostitele systému. Zobrazuje také distribuci Linuxu a verzi jádra:

hostnamectl
  Static hostname:  linuxize.localdomain
         Icon name: computer-laptop
           Chassis: laptop
        Machine ID: af8ce1d394b844fea8c19ea5c6a9bd09
           Boot ID: 15bc3ae7bde842f29c8d925044f232b9
  Operating System: Ubuntu 18.04.2 LTS
            Kernel: Linux 4.15.0-54-generic
      Architecture: x86-64

Můžete použít grep příkaz k odfiltrování verze linuxového jádra:

hostnamectl | grep -i kernel
            Kernel: Linux 4.15.0-54-generic

Pomocí /proc/version Soubor #

/proc adresář obsahuje virtuální soubory s informacemi o systémové paměti, jádrech CPU, připojených souborových systémech a další. Informace o běžícím jádře jsou uloženy v /proc/version virtuální soubor.

Použijte cat nebo less pro zobrazení obsahu souboru:

cat /proc/version

Výstup bude vypadat nějak takto:

Linux version 4.15.0-54-generic (buildd@lgw01-amd64-014) (gcc version 7.4.0 (Ubuntu 7.4.0-1ubuntu1~18.04.1)) #58-Ubuntu SMP Mon Jun 24 10:55:24 UTC 2019

Závěr č.

Ukázali jsme vám, jak zjistit verzi linuxového jádra běžícího na vašem systému z příkazového řádku. Příkazy by měly fungovat na všech populárních distribucích Linuxu včetně Debian, Red Hat, Ubuntu, Arch Linux, Fedora, CentOS, Kali Linux, OpenSUSE, Linux Mint a dalších.

Pokud máte nějaké dotazy, neváhejte zanechat komentář.


Linux
  1. Jak zkontrolovat verzi jádra v Linuxu

  2. Jak zkontrolovat verzi operačního systému Linux

  3. Jak zkontrolovat HZ v terminálu?

  1. Jak zkontrolovat verzi Redhat

  2. Jak zkontrolovat verzi OS a Linuxu

  3. Jak zkontrolovat verzi jádra Linuxu v Ubuntu?

  1. Jak zkontrolovat verzi MySQL na Linuxu

  2. Jak zkontrolovat verzi MySQL v Linuxu

  3. jak zkontrolovat verzi linux X11?